Redwood Trust, Inc. is a U.S.-based specialty finance company organized as a mortgage REIT, and this listing represents its Preferred Stock, Series A on the New York Stock Exchange. Through its subsidiaries, the company operates several mortgage-related businesses, including loan acquisition, origination, securitization, sale, and portfolio investment activities. Its reported segments include Sequoia Mortgage Banking, CoreVest Mortgage Banking, Redwood Investments, and Legacy Investments. Redwood’s investment activity is centered on housing credit risk and on retained interests from its own securitizations and related investment vehicles, reflecting a strategic shift toward internally originated assets. The Legacy Investments segment contains assets no longer aligned with current priorities and is being reduced through sale, runoff, or other disposition. Redwood Trust was incorporated in 1994 and is headquartered in Mill Valley, California.
